Creative Exchange is a European gathering for architecture and design lovers and professionals. As a multi-day public event with lectures, talks, presentations, pitches and cocktails, Creative Exchange will enable meetings and live interaction between cultural operators, emerging creatives and audiences through various formats. Applicants of the Call for Ideas, members and other cultural operators in architecture and design will present their latest developments, new projects and new ideas. The Future Architecture Matchmaking Conference will feature selected Future Architecture emerging creative, three winners of the Fundació Mies van der Rohe Young Talent Architecture Award 2016, and enable members to plan their involvement in the programme modules. Focus Talks will address pressing professional issues and enable members and creatives to gain new knowledge. The Future Architecture Fair will provide cultural operators and emerging creatives in architecture a forum in which to present their work at an exhibition, to meet partners and examine opportunities.
